Transaction 7703ca933ea65f51033a3ab412aa9d1958b3f62017b0b6358328537e1d5c9aa7
1 Input
1 Output
-
7703ca933ea65f51033a3ab412aa9d1958b3f62017b0b6358328537e1d5c9aa7:0
- value
- 10019236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a55537760539f0ded48e45fa48e4cf21be537ec OP_EQUAL
- address
- 3HDf1iFtWBX4FUZ2D7WGv2NWK1uFQRJWvT